Paparazzi
The term paparazzi refers to freelance photographers who aggressively pursue and photograph celebrities, often without their consent, in order to sell the images to media outlets. The presence of paparazzi can be a significant contributing factor to Elizabeth Olsen having a bad day.
Paparazzi can cause celebrities to feel harassed, stressed, and anxious. They may also invade celebrities' privacy by taking photos of them in private or embarrassing situations. In some cases, paparazzi have even been known to physically assault celebrities.
The case of Elizabeth Olsen highlights the negative impact that paparazzi can have on celebrities' lives. Olsen has been photographed by paparazzi on numerous occasions, and she has spoken out about how their presence makes her feel uncomfortable and unsafe.
